About

Baruch S. Shasha is a scholar working on Plant Science, Molecular Biology and Organic Chemistry. According to data from OpenAlex, Baruch S. Shasha has authored 83 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Plant Science, 26 papers in Molecular Biology and 25 papers in Organic Chemistry. Recurrent topics in Baruch S. Shasha’s work include Insect Resistance and Genetics (19 papers), Insect Pest Control Strategies (18 papers) and Carbohydrate Chemistry and Synthesis (15 papers). Baruch S. Shasha is often cited by papers focused on Insect Resistance and Genetics (19 papers), Insect Pest Control Strategies (18 papers) and Carbohydrate Chemistry and Synthesis (15 papers). Baruch S. Shasha collaborates with scholars based in United States, Israel and Mexico. Baruch S. Shasha's co-authors include Michael R. McGuire, D. Trimnell, W. M. Doane, Camille Rustenholz, Robert W. Behle, F. H. Otey, C. E. Rist, Patricia Tamez‐Guerra, Gayland F. Spencer and Steven F. Vaughn and has published in prestigious journals such as Nature, Journal of Agricultural and Food Chemistry and Journal of Controlled Release.
